To find three consecutive integers, we need to use algebraic expressions. Let the three consecutive integers be represented by the variable xx, where xx is the first integer. The next two consecutive integers can be written as x+1x+1 and x+2x+2.

For example, if the first integer is 5, then the three consecutive integers are:

  • First integer: 55
  • Second integer: 5+1=65 + 1 = 6
  • Third integer: 5+2=75 + 2 = 7

These integers are consecutive because each one is exactly one more than the previous one.

Steps:

  1. Assign a variable xx to represent the first integer.
  2. Write the next two consecutive integers as x+1x+1 and x+2x+2.
  3. You can now use these expressions to solve for unknowns when given additional information, such as the sum or product of the integers.

For example, if you are given that the sum of the three integers is 42, you can write the equation: x+(x+1)+(x+2)=42x + (x + 1) + (x + 2) = 42

Simplify the equation: 3x+3=423x + 3 = 42

Now, subtract 3 from both sides: 3x=393x = 39

Then, divide by 3: x=13x = 13

Thus, the three consecutive integers are 1313, 1414, and 1515.

This process can be applied to any scenario involving three consecutive integers. The general method is to represent the integers algebraically and use additional information, like their sum or product, to solve for xx.
